![]()  | 
    
    ||
| 
			
			
			
			 Basic Member 
			
		
			
			
			加入日期: Sep 2001 
					文章: 25
					
				 
				 | 
	
	
		
			
			 
				
				程式的 source code 本身可以用 Unicode 編碼嗎?
		
	 
					
			程式的 source code(不論 compile 後執行 
				
		
或用 interpret),似乎都是用 ASCII code 編碼較多。 好奇想問一下,若 source code 本身以 Unicode 裡的 UTF-16 或 UTF-8 編碼,是否也可以被 正確地 compile/interpret?謝謝。  | 
|||||||
| 
      
				 | 
| 
			
			
			
			 Power Member 
			![]() ![]() 加入日期: Jan 2002 您的住址: Taipei 
				
				
					文章: 664
					
				 
				 | 
	
	
		
		
		
									  
		
		 UTF-16 不相容於 ASCII, 所以應該不會有程式支援吧. 除非那程式就只能用 UTF-16, 不能用 ASCII. 
				
		
UTF-8, 如果沒有 BOM 的話, 應該都有支援吧. 反正一般的語法都只會用到 ASCII 的部份, 並不會不相容. 會出現非 ASCII 的其它 UTF-8 字元時, 不是在字串內 (只要執行環境也是 UTF-8, 自然看的懂那文字), 就是在註解 (對程式完全沒影響). 如果有 BOM 的話, 應該都不支援吧... BOM 會被認為是錯誤. 
				__________________ 
		
		
		
		
	
	   Tommy 碎碎念...  | 
||
| 
      
				 | 
| 
			
			
			
			 Major Member 
			![]() 加入日期: Nov 2001 
					文章: 298
					
				 
				 | 
	
	
		
		
		
									  
		
		 編譯/解譯 程式認識的話就可以啦!例如 Java 就可以! 
				
		
		
		
		
		
		
		
		
	
	 | 
| 
      
				 |